As you already know, I have a new book out. It follows the adventures of three kids, and when I first started working on it, I liked the characters so much that I thought it would be a waste not to let them have more adventures.

(That’s them!)

So, I pitched it to Planeta as a series. I’m not contractually obligated to write it, but the plan is to make two more books with the same kids, and a mystery for them to solve.

Last summer, as soon as I finished the text of the book that came out now, I started panicking about what I would do next. I can’t take too long in between books! They are for children… and children GROW!

I started researching and planning out a new story. I had to put it on hold for a bit, but now, for the past 2 months, I have been working on it daily, and I just finished the first draft! YEY! It’s still a first step, but it’s progress!

I’m not sure if it was the planning, or the fact that I already knew the characters, but this time everything went so much smoother. I took a lot of pleasure from sitting down to write, which never happens. (To me, writing is always a bit like doing exercise — I never feel like doing it, but I‘m very happy once I have done it)

In this new story, Nora, Rute and Diogo will go to a summer camp. Some weird things happen, and they suspect there is a ghost haunting the woods. As it always happens once you start writing a book, things connected to your story start to appear everywhere! I was walking in a garden in Brussels and saw a teeepee exactly like the one I had imagined my characters building. I’m reading that as a sign to keep on!
